What does sky mean?
Sky means The atmosphere above a given point, especially as visible from the surface of the Earth as the place where the sun, moon, stars, and clouds are seen..
/skaɪ/ · noun
The atmosphere above a given point, especially as visible from the surface of the Earth as the place where the sun, moon, stars, and clouds are seen..
That year, a meteor fell from the sky.

Sky means The atmosphere above a given point, especially as visible from the surface of the Earth as the place where the sun, moon, stars, and clouds are seen..
Common synonyms include blue, firmament, heaven, lift.
Possible antonyms include floor.
